How they compare

Turkmenistan currently reports 427.75 terawatt-hours against 403.05 terawatt-hours in Colombia, a difference of 24.7 terawatt-hours.

That makes Turkmenistan's figure about 1.1 times Colombia's.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 41 shared years of data; in 1985 it was Colombia ahead.

Colombia ranks 47th and Turkmenistan ranks 46th of 220 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Colombia averaged higher in 4 and Turkmenistan in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Colombia Turkmenistan Difference Ahead
1980s 174.78 terawatt-hours 172 terawatt-hours 2.78 terawatt-hours Colombia
1990s 215.83 terawatt-hours 135.44 terawatt-hours 80.39 terawatt-hours Colombia
2000s 240.7 terawatt-hours 167.15 terawatt-hours 73.56 terawatt-hours Colombia
2010s 363.13 terawatt-hours 307.75 terawatt-hours 55.38 terawatt-hours Colombia
2020s 413.09 terawatt-hours 423.69 terawatt-hours 10.6 terawatt-hours Turkmenistan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
